## Local Setup — Ladleworks Recipe Scaler

To review the scaling logic end to end, run the app locally rather than relying on unit tests alone, since rounding behavior for fractional units only shows up with real ingredient data. Install dependencies with `make deps`, then seed the sample recipe set via `make seed`, which loads about 200 recipes covering metric and imperial units. The seed script and the app both expect a reachable database; connect with the string below.

replica DSN, kajep-yahag: mssql://praok_svc:iF@db-8d68.plorvaio.local:5432/eliion

**Ticket #—: Vault locked, tax-rate cache refresh blocked**

Hey, flagging this for security review. The Tallowbrook tax-rate lookup cache failed its nightly refresh because the secrets vault auto-locked after three bad unseal attempts (looks like a clock-skew thing on the batch runner, not an attack). Rates are now a day stale and the Perchlan billing team is getting antsy. Can you approve the unlock? To re-seed the cache after unsealing, you'll need the recovery passphrase noted below.

recovery phrase for bawep-kawef: oliath-casdor

## v4.12.0 — Digest scheduler rename

Heads up: `DIGEST_CRON_WINDOW` is now `DIGEST_BATCH_SCHEDULE`. The old name silently broke after the Quillmark migration, so batch email digests were firing at midnight UTC instead of per-tenant local time. If you're on call and digests look late, check this first — the scheduler logs a warning but doesn't fail. Update your local env before restarting the worker. The new setting also requires the signing credential for the digest queue, so add it on the next line.

secret setting of yafof-tawep: RELAY_SECRET8=8abb5772